Science and Technology Education Key Learning Area

 

The Science Education KLA aims to provide students with a broad range of learning experiences that enable them to build a solid foundation in science, nurture their scientific literacy, and acquire the ability to integrate and apply relevant knowledge and skills across KLAs, including science, technology, engineering, and mathematics. Students develop positive values and attitudes that enhance their personal development as scientifically literate citizens and more effective lifelong learners in the 21st century.

 

The Science Education KLA includes Integrated Science, Computer Science, school-based STEM classroom curriculum at junior secondary levels, and science and technology-related elective subjects, including Physics, Chemistry, Biology, and Information and Communication Technology, at senior secondary levels. Through classroom, hands-on, and brain-based explorative learning activities, each subject aims to nurture students’ interest in science and build their scientific knowledge, thereby nurturing the students into self-motivated science learners who value learning.

 

Given the interdisciplinary nature of the development of science, technology and mathematics, the disciplines within the Science Education KLA are closely linked to mathematics to promote STEM education in our school. We aim to build a solid knowledge foundation in STEM-related areas and to enhance students’ ability to integrate and apply interdisciplinary knowledge and skills, thereby nurturing their universal competencies such as creativity, innovative thinking, collaboration, and problem-solving. These are essential skills and qualities for life in the 21st century. By designing and producing practical products and participating in other follow-up activities such as explaining inventions, students can integrate different areas of knowledge and apply universal skills in solving real-life problems.
